Boyne Highlands Snow Report – 03/20

Well the time has come, it is our final day of the season. It is bittersweet to say goodbye to another fun season on the slopes but we can look forward to the next one. Get the most out of the final day with turns across 41 runs and 338 acres of terrain. Lifts are spinning from 9am-4:30pm, get out and catch a chair! The sun should be out in the morning with clouds slowly moving in. We can expect a high around 37F and calm winds.

We thank everyone again for another fun season and we look forward to seeing you again soon!
